Discover LudwigThe phrase "a spreadsheet"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when referring to a digital document that organizes data in rows and columns, typically used for calculations and data analysis.
Example: "I created a spreadsheet to track our monthly expenses and income."
Alternatives: "an Excel sheet" or "a data table".
